A temperature-stabilized programmable operational amplifier for active-R filters
International Journal of Electronics, 1980A monolithic operational amplifier circuit, has been designed whose gain and bandwidth are virtually independent of temperature. Defined accurately by ratios of external resistances, the gain and 3 dB cutoff frequency are controllable from 40 dB to l00 dB and 15 Hz. to 1 kHz respectively.

Evaluation of alternative grain stabilization programmes for Nigerian food security
Agricultural Administration and Extension, 1988Abstract Annual fluctuations in Nigerian grain supplies are large and uncertain. The amelioration of these fluctuations through reserve programmes to achieve reasonable stability is technically feasible. This paper analyses the effectiveness of two alternative grain reserve programmes in meeting specific stabilization goals in Nigeria.

Modelling Rectifier Loads for a Multi-Machine Transient-Stability Programme
IEEE Transactions on Power Apparatus and Systems, 1980An improved rectifier load model for use in transient-stability studies is developed. The model, which simulates abnormal modes of operation and the dynamics of the d.c. load, is used to investigate the stability of a power-system where the rectifier can represent a large percentage of load.

FoxM1 is required for execution of the mitotic programme and chromosome stability
Nature Cell Biology, 2005Transcriptional induction of cell-cycle regulatory proteins ensures proper timing of subsequent cell-cycle events. Here we show that the Forkhead transcription factor FoxM1 regulates expression of many G2-specific genes and is essential for chromosome stability.

Note: Low phase noise programmable phase-locked loop with high temperature stability
Review of Scientific Instruments, 2017The design and construction of low jitter programmable phase-locked loop with low temperature coefficient of phase are presented. It has been designed for demanding high precision timing applications, especially as a clock source for event timer with subpicosecond precision. The phase-locked loop itself has a jitter of few hundreds of femtoseconds.
